On Fri, Mar 18, 2022 at 05:00:48PM +0100, Clément Léger wrote:
Add fwnode_find_i2c_adapter_by_node() which allows to retrieve a i2c
adapter using a fwnode. Since dev_fwnode() uses the fwnode provided by
the of_node member of the device, this will also work for devices were
the of_node has been set and not the fwnode field.
+	/* For ACPI device node, we do not want to match the parent */
Why?
Neither commit message nor this comment does not answer to this question.
